What is margin

Margin is a financial metric that expresses the difference between a company's revenue and costs, usually as a percentage of sales. It shows how efficiently a company converts revenue into profit. Margin is crucial for assessing a company's financial health and its ability to generate earnings.

Types of margin

  • Gross margin – takes into account only the direct costs of producing goods or delivering services.
  • Operating margin – also includes operating costs such as wages, rent, or marketing.
  • Net margin – accounts for all costs including interest, taxes, and extraordinary items.

Why margin matters

  • Measures profitability – a higher margin means the company has more room for profit from each unit of revenue.
  • Efficiency benchmark – allows comparisons of performance among companies in the same industry.
  • Strategic decision-making – margin helps investors and managers assess whether the company can grow sustainably and withstand competitive pressure.

Factors affecting margin

  • Pricing policy – the ability to set prices in line with the value of the product.
  • Cost structure – production and operational efficiency.
  • Competitive environment – pressure to cut prices can reduce margins.
  • Economic conditions – inflation, exchange rates, and market demand.
